      Using the supplied buildah task to build a nodejs container - requires around 4GB of memory. The cluster has a ResourceQuota set and a LimitRange and he is following the guide [1]. However because the buildah task has 3 steps, It will need to set the LimitRange to 4GB*3 = 12GB. However the worker nodes only have 16GB RAM, so it will struggle to schedule the pod.
      Upstream in the tekton catalog and the buildah Task there only has one step which would solve the problem. Can this be pulled into the next version of OpenShift Pipelines, please?[2]
